Nawrotzki’s Algorithm for the Countable Splitting Lemma, Constructively ((Co)algebraic pearls)

Authors Ana Sokolova, Harald Woracek

Thumbnail PDF


  • Filesize: 0.64 MB
  • 16 pages

Document Identifiers

Author Details

Ana Sokolova
  • Department of Computer Sciences, University of Salzburg, Austria
Harald Woracek
  • Institute of Analysis and Scientific Computing, TU Wien, Austria


We are indebted to Paul Levy for bringing this topic to us by asking us several years ago to figure out some details of Nawrotzki’s algorithm, in particular its constructivity.

Cite AsGet BibTex

Ana Sokolova and Harald Woracek. Nawrotzki’s Algorithm for the Countable Splitting Lemma, Constructively ((Co)algebraic pearls). In 9th Conference on Algebra and Coalgebra in Computer Science (CALCO 2021). Leibniz International Proceedings in Informatics (LIPIcs), Volume 211, pp. 23:1-23:16,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2021)


We reprove the countable splitting lemma by adapting Nawrotzki’s algorithm which produces a sequence that converges to a solution. Our algorithm combines Nawrotzki’s approach with taking finite cuts. It is constructive in the sense that each term of the iteratively built approximating sequence as well as the error between the approximants and the solution is computable with finitely many algebraic operations.

Subject Classification

ACM Subject Classification
  • Mathematics of computing → Mathematical analysis
  • Mathematics of computing → Probability and statistics
  • Theory of computation → Design and analysis of algorithms
  • Theory of computation → Semantics and reasoning
  • countable splitting lemma
  • distributions with given marginals
  • couplings


